Mac 电脑前端环境配置
恍惚间,好久没有在外面写过随笔了。在阿里的那两年,学到了许多,也成长了许多,认识了很多可爱的人,也明白了很多社会的事。最后种种艰难抉择,我来到了美团成都,一个贫穷落后但更自由开放弹性的地方。已经误以为不打卡是对程序猿的保护,现在发现打卡上下班才是最好的保护,且不深谈~
新的环境开始配置新的电脑,本来把之前电脑上的一些重要配置都有弄成一个文件准备带过来的,好像上传个人钉盘被和谐掉了,只好自己再弄一次。
1、打开电脑,联网,登录 icould,itunes,etc
2、升级电脑系统(反正迟早是要升级的),期间可以下一些东西或者按照公司内部软件
3、appStore xcode (自带 git),打开 Xcode->open Developer Tool ->Simulator,准备仿真机调试环境
(网速慢的可以参照 https://blog.csdn.net/snowrain1108/article/details/51325040 或者先科学上网;
这里是别人的使用心得;
这里是命令行控制 simulator,但是少了我最常用的一行命名 xcrun simctl openurl booted https://xxxx 直接在当前 app 中打开某个网址)
1)与此配合使用,safari 浏览器->偏好设置->高级->在菜单栏显示开发菜单
2)由于还会用到 RN,因此需要稍微配置一下 ios 的开发环境。安装cocoapods http://www.code4app.com/article/cocoapods-install-usage
4、控制台相关环境
1)安装 brew 、wget
2)安装 node,nvm
3)iterm2+zsh+ oh-my-zsh,修改 shell 为 zsh,并在 ~/.zshrc 里面配置自己习惯的 alias
# zsh theme
ZSH_THEME="avit" # alias
alias tar="tar -xvf"
alias gz="tar -xzvf"
alias tgz="tar -xzvf"
alias bz2="tar -xjvf"
alias zip="unzip"
alias gaa="git add --all"
alias gcmsg="git commit -m"
alias gpo="git push origin"
alias mi="cnpm install"
alias ms="cnpm start" # 配置 vscode 的快速打开文件
alias vsc='/Applications/Visual\ Studio\ Code.app/Contents/Resources/app/bin/code';
VSC_BIN='/Applications/Visual\ Studio\ Code.app/Contents/Resources/app/bin';
PATH=$VSC_BIN:$PATH;
5、安装 vscode,参照小胡子哥的经验《如何快速上手一款 IDE - VSC 配置指南和插件推荐》。虽然有 vscode,但是习惯性还是安装 sublime 做日常使用,比如做复制粘贴板,sublime 官网,插件参照知乎《sublime text 3 插件推荐》即可。
6、安装 photoshop、microsoft office、charles、ihost 的破解版(公司没有正式版,又穷。。。)
7、markdown 推荐 markeditor,用习惯的我都买了 pro 了。邮件推荐网易邮箱大师。 窗口控制推荐 spectacle,可以很方便的切窗口的位置和大小,尤其是 chrome。
8、chrome 插件推荐:QRcode、FE helper、edit this cookie、postman、json handle、octotree、React Devolper Tools、Gliffy Diagrams 等,具体用途安装的时候看一下就知道了
9、娱乐相关的微信、qq、网易云音乐~~~
10、科学上网。需求来源为绘图,之前用 draw.io 实现过一个内部协同绘图系统,然后就习惯了 draw.io 了。现在没机器配,所以就直接用官网的,存储支持 Google Drive,于是乎去注册 google 账号,云邮箱等。翻墙使用 https://xiongmao.io/,https://xn--t75a9a.com/ 等。
Mac 电脑前端环境配置的更多相关文章
- Mac上Node环境配置
公司配备Mac笔记本,以前没用过mac开发项目,一开始依然是从node官网下载安装包,后来领导说最好是用brew安装软件,这样比较方便,安装和卸载,只要在命令行输入相应的 install 和 unin ...
- Jmeter----【Mac电脑】环境配置与打开Jmeter界面
前提条件:打开Jmeter界面,首先需要安装java并配置环境变量. 第一步:下载并安装jdk和环境配置 java jdk下载:http://www.oracle.com/technetwork/ja ...
- MAC下 JDK环境配置、版本切换以及ADB环境配置
网上方法,自己总结:亲测可行! 一.JDK环境配置.版本切换: 通过命令’jdk6′, ‘jdk7′,’jdk8’轻松切换到对应的Java版本: 1.首先安装所有的JDk:* Mac自带了的JDK6, ...
- Mac 终端 Tomcat 环境配置过程
Tomcat是Apache 软件基金会(Apache Software Foundation)的Jakarta 项目中的一个核心项目,由Apache.Sun 和其他一些公司及个人共同开发而成.Tomc ...
- mac系统vscode环境配置,以及iTerm2配置Zsh + on-my-zsh shell
https://segmentfault.com/a/1190000013612471?utm_source=tag-newest https://ohmyz.sh/ 一:安装iTerm2终端 htt ...
- Mysql for Mac 安装及环境配置
一.下载及安装 首先去官网下载mac对应版本的Mysql,尾缀为.dmg的程序包 下载地址:https://dev.mysql.com/downloads/mysql/ 下载完毕后,一步步傻瓜式安装即 ...
- Mac下Nginx环境配置
环境信息: Mac OS X 10.11.1 Homebrew 0.9.5 正文 一.安装 Nginx 终端执行: brew search nginx brew install nginx 当前版本 ...
- MAC Java 开发环境配置
JDK Oracle官网 -> Download -> Java for Developers -> Java SE Downloads -> Java Platform (J ...
- Mac 下 Gradle 环境配置
1. gradle路径的查找 然后gradle 右键 显示简介 复制下蓝色的 2. 环境变量的配置 在.bash_profile文件中,添加如下图选中内容的配置信息: 执行source .bash_p ...
随机推荐
- 学习笔记-JS公开课三
DOM技术概述 DOM : DocumentObject Model 将HTML标记型文档,封装成对象,提供更多的属性和行为 DOM的三级模型 第一级:将标记型文档,封装成对象,提供更多的属性和行为 ...
- WIP 投料报 Invalid Serial Number
1.接口表数据检查无误 2.同样数据界面能正常完成 界面做trace SQL ID: b2mw8gjyv7guh Plan Hash: 2015965341 DELETE FROM MTL_SERIA ...
- eclipse new server Cannot create a server using the selected type 网上有两种办法,其实原理一样
eclipse new server Cannot create a server using the selected type 网上有两种办法,其实原理一样 第一种说法: 还真的找到解决的方法了, ...
- UNIX环境高级编程——线程与进程区别
进程和线程都是由操作系统所体会的程序运行的基本单元,系统利用该基本单元实现系统对应用的并发性.进程和线程的区别在于: (1)一个程序至少有一个进程,一个进程至少有一个线程. (2)线程的划分尺度小于进 ...
- Gradle 1.12 翻译——第十七章. 从 Gradle 中调用 Ant
有关其他已翻译的章节请关注Github上的项目:https://github.com/msdx/gradledoc/tree/1.12,或访问:http://gradledoc.qiniudn.com ...
- iOS中 SDWebImage手动清除缓存的方法 技术分享
1.找到SDImageCache类 2.添加如下方法: - (float)checkTmpSize { float totalSize = 0; NSDirectoryEnumerator *file ...
- spring揭秘 读书笔记 六 bean的一生
我们知道,Spring容器具有对象的BeanDefinition来保存该对象实例化时需要的数据. 对象通过container.getBean()方法是才会初始化该对象. BeanFactory 我们知 ...
- LayoutInflater和inflate的用法,有图有真相
1.概述 有时候在我们的Activity中用到别的layout,并且要对其组件进行操作,比如: A.acyivity是获取网络数据的,对应布局文件为A.xml,然后需要把这个数据设置到B.xml的组件 ...
- JavaScript进阶(八)JS实现图片预览并导入服务器功能
JS实现导入文件功能 赠人玫瑰,手留余香.若您感觉此篇博文对您有用,请花费2秒时间点个赞,您的鼓励是我不断前进的动力,共勉!(PS:此篇博文是自己在午饭时间所写,为此没吃午饭,这就是程序猿 ...
- 安全退出app,activoty栈管理
前言 由于一个同学问到我如何按照一个流程走好之后回到首页,我以前看到过4个解决方案,后来发现有做个记录和总结的必要,就写了这篇博文.(之前看小强也写过一篇,这里通过自身的分析完整的总结一下以下6种方案 ...